Gravatar I remember watching 21-year-old Tiger tear up the 1997 Masters. One of the TV announcers blurted out that they would have to change the rules. It wouldn’t have been the first time. College basketball banned the dunk in 1967 after Kareem Abdul-Jabbar’s debut season. (He responded by developing the ‘sky hook’.) Hall of Fame UNC coach Dean Smith used the ‘four corners’ stall offense at the end of games for decades. In 1984 Georgetown’s all-Black team employed the same tactic, making John Thompson Jr. the first African American head coach to win the college men's hoop title. The NCAA adopted the shot clock in 1985.
